Print Segig 1 is a bold, narrow, medium cont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A lively, hand-drawn print style with thick, rounded strokes and softly tapered terminals that suggest a marker or brush pen. Letterforms are compact and slightly condensed, with gentle irregularities in curves and stroke joins that keep the texture organic. Counters are small to moderate, curves are exaggerated, and many shapes lean on simplified, cartoon-like geometry for strong silhouette readability. Spacing feels open and forgiving, helping the heavy strokes avoid clogging in short words and headlines.
Well suited to short, high-impact settings such as posters, packaging callouts, stickers, social media graphics, and playful branding. It works especially well where an inviting, handcrafted voice is needed—titles, headers, captions, and display copy—rather than dense text blocks.
The overall tone is cheerful and informal, with a bouncy rhythm that reads as approachable and a bit mischievous. Its chunky forms and softened edges create a kid-friendly, DIY personality suited to lighthearted messaging.
Designed to deliver a bold, friendly handwritten feel with clean, unconnected letters that stay readable at display sizes. The consistent heaviness and rounded construction aim to communicate warmth and fun while preserving simple, dependable letter shapes.
Uppercase and lowercase are clearly differentiated and maintain consistent stroke weight, while the numerals match the same rounded, hand-rendered logic. The font’s character comes more from subtle shape variation and swollen curves than from slant or connected script behavior, keeping it legible while still distinctly handmade.
